Tower of the Elephant which is one of the original REH Conan stories is public domain.
"The Tower of the Elephant ... As this work's copyright was not renewed, it entered the public domain on 1 January 1962. The longest-living author of this work died in 1936, so this work is in the public domain in countries and areas where the copyright term is the author's life plus 86 years or less."
